In order to protect installments from a prospective explosion a technique of analysing and identifying a potentially dangerous location is required. The purpose of this is to guarantee the appropriate option and setup of equipment to eventually avoid a surge and to guarantee safety of life.

The equipment register is a detailed data source of equipment documents that includes a minimum set of areas to determine each product's area, technological criteria, Ex classification, age, and environmental information. This info is crucial for monitoring and taking care of the tools effectively within hazardous areas. It issues of modern-day life that we make, save or handle a series of gases or liquids that are deemed flammable, and a variety of dusts that are regarded combustible. These substances can, in certain conditions, develop explosive atmospheres and these can have major and awful effects. A lot of us know with the fire triangle get rid of any type of one of the 3 elements and the fire can not happen, however what does this mean in the context of unsafe locations? When breaking this down into its most read this post here basic terms it is basically: a combination of a particular amount of release or leakage of a particular material or product, blending with ambient oxygen, and the visibility of a resource of ignition.


In many instances, we can do little regarding the degrees of oxygen in the air, but we can have significant influence on sources of ignition, as an example electrical devices. Harmful locations are documented on the hazardous area category drawing and are recognized on-site by the triangular "EX-SPOUSE" indicator. Below, amongst various other key details, zones are split into three kinds depending on the risk, the likelihood and duration that an explosive atmosphere will certainly exist; Zone 0 or 20 is deemed the most hazardous and Area 2 or 22 is considered the least.
